THCa Flower
THCA, or Tetrahydrocannabinolic Acid, is a naturally occurring compound found in raw cannabis plants. Unlike its well-known cousin, THC (Tetrahydrocannabinol), THCA is non-psychoactive. When heated or decarboxylated, THCA transforms into THC, the compound responsible for the euphoric and psychoactive effects commonly associated with cannabis consumption.
